Ten Hill Place is one of Edinburgh’s most desirable city-center hotels. Our stylish hotel boasts a number of awards including conference hotel of the year 2015 and hotel chef of the year. We have 129 bedrooms, and are consistently praised for our very friendly staff and going that extra mile to ensure our guests enjoy their stay. As a result, we have many customers that visit us repeatedly. We are a matter of minutes away from all Edinburgh city-center attractions by foot and are close to all local transport links if you want to venture that little bit further. Our wine-bar and restaurant provide the best quality Scottish produce with a vast plethora of Corney and Barrow wines. We are Edinburgh's charitable hotel and donate profits to The Royal College of Surgeons of Edinburgh. Money spent at the hotel improves patient outcomes and saves lives the world over by delivering much needed surgical skills to all corners of the globe. We thoroughly enjoyed our 3 nights here. It's a modern, stylish, independent hotel in a great location. All the city centre attractions are within a 10-15 minute walk including the castle, Royal Mile, Prince's St and Holyrood Palace. Also, numerous bars and restaurants. You can even walk to the top of Arthur's Seat in less than 1 hour. Our room was lovely, a good size with a large bathroom and very comfy bed. We ate in the hotel restaurant on the first night. There was a good variety on the menu and the food was well cooked, presented and tasty. Breakfast was standard buffet but with some welcome Scottish elements including haggis. All the staff were friendly, helpful and gave a great service
